Definition
Name
Can cause death if swallowed, breathed in or absorbed by skin
Poisonous
Attacks and destroys living tissues such as skin and eyes
Corrosive
Substances that can self-react
Explosive
Provides oxygen to make other substances burn more violently
Oxidising
Damaging to living tissue, possibly causin DNA damage and mutations
Radiation
Catches fire easily
Highly flammable
Biological substances that pose a threat to human health
Biohazard
Substances that can damage the enviroment if released
Environmentaly damaging
